NGK makes most of the GM Iridum plugs. I got ticked when I paid the dealer for plugs for my shortstar back in the day and it turns out they were EXACTLY the same as the NGK at the auto parts store for half the price. Gm had given them their own PN on the box, but you open them up and they are labeled NGK with an NGK PN.
